[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Verifica��o se a rede est� ativa
From: |
Copag |
Subject: |
Verificação se a rede está ativa |
Date: |
Mon, 29 Jul 2002 02:45:10 -0300 |
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Olá pessoal, como estão?
Estou montando um shell script aqui, que ativa os serviços de rede
automaticamente.
Tudo funcionou muito bem, mas eu queria adicionar uma forma de que, se a
máquina de lá tivesse desligada, ele não fizesse nada com montagem de
diretórios, porém, se ele checasse e tivesse ligada, ele montava os diretórios
compartilhados no /etc/exports.
Eu havia feito isso:
if ping -c 1 192.168.0.2; then
mount linkin:/home/copag /mnt/copag && echo "Diretórios montados com
sucesso!"
else
echo "A outra máquina está desligada, tente manualmente mais tarde!"
fi
Só que eu tive um problema. Se a máquina está desligada, ele fica parado no
mount um tempão. Bom, isso quer dizer que, ela estando ligada ou não, o ping
retorna um resultado, e o script está sempre entendendo como se a resposta do
if fosse verdadeira.
Existe outro comando que eu possa colocar no script para verificar se a máquina
está ligada ou não, ou pelo menos se ela responde? Ou então, mesmo fazendo com
o ping, existe uma forma correta do funcionamento disso?
Agradeço desde já pela atenção dispensada.
Atenciosamente,
.'~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~|
| João Paulo BrÃgido Tostes |
| (o_.' Copag [ address@hidden ] |
| (o_ (o_ //\ #LinuxBQ | BrasIRC.NeT |
| (/)_ (\)_ V_/_ LinuxBQ - Linux ao alcance de todos! |
| http://www.linuxbq.org |
| Linux User Registered #176331 | UIN #47176203 |
| Chave pública PGP: http://copag.linuxbq.org |
`-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~-~~'
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.0.6 (GNU/Linux)
Comment: For info see http://www.gnupg.org
iD8DBQE9RNZeWI9/Ie6yiwERArKoAJ9ZcQqWbaqMyh5MQ76Th9+hZbl3YACeOeYA
9luPtJjq+GBqIpY2XcM0LHc=
=M8oB
-----END PGP SIGNATURE-----
- Verificação se a rede está ativa,
Copag <=